La Mesa-Spring Valley board approves consent items, audit, solar exemptions and fee increases

La Mesa-Spring Valley School Board · January 14, 2026

At its Jan. 13 meeting the La Mesa-Spring Valley School Board approved minutes and the agenda, multiple consent packages, the annual audit, authorization for solar project exemptions (with two schools deferred), and fee increases for Extended Student Services and Smart Steps preschool effective July 1.

The La Mesa-Spring Valley School Board on Jan. 13 approved multiple routine and substantive items, including the annual audit, consent packages, authorization to file notices of exemption for solar projects, and fee increases for the district’s Extended Student Services (ESS) and Smart Steps preschool programs.
